Makefile.in (dce.o): Add $(EXCEPT_H).
* Makefile.in (dce.o): Add $(EXCEPT_H). * dce.c: Include except.h and delete redundant vector definitions. (deletable_insn_p): Return false for non-call insns that can throw if DF is running. From-SVN: r147002
